The dpkg history log contains: Start-Date: 2017-01-06 21:09:48 Commandline: aptdaemon role='role-upgrade-system' sender=':1.77' Install: [...] Error: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g exited unexpectedly End-Date: 2017-01-06 21:11:03
This looks like dpkg crashed, which would explain why libavformat is in a bad/inconsistent state.
